This article explains how to delete uploaded contracts and in-house templates from LegalOn, including version-specific and bulk deletion options.


Delete a file from the File detail page

To delete a specific version

  1. Go to the [Contracts] or [My templates] list.

  2. Click on the file you want to delete.

  3. Hover on the right to reveal the menu, then click the [Versions] tab.

  4. Click [… ] → [Delete this version] next to the target version.

  5. Confirm the prompt by clicking [Delete].
    → A confirmation message will appear: "Version deleted."

To delete all versions of a file

  1. Follow steps 1–2 above to open the File detail page.

  2. Click [… ] → [Delete all versions] in the upper-right corner.

  3. Confirm by clicking [Delete].

The file will be removed from the list view and a message will appear: "File deleted."

Delete from the File editor

You can also delete files from the File editor.

  1. Open the file using steps 1–2 above.

  2. Click [Review] to open the File Editor.
    → If you do not have the Review module, click [Edit] instead.

  3. In the editor, click [… ] → [Delete this version] or [Delete all versions].

  4. Confirm the action in the prompt.

Deletion options summary

Option

Action

Delete this version

Only deletes the currently displayed version

Delete all versions

Deletes the entire file and removes it from the list view

Delete files from the List view in bulk

  1. In the [Contracts] list view, select the checkboxes for the files you want to delete.

  2. Click [Delete] at the top of the screen.

💡 Info

You can select and delete up to 50 files per page.
